I don't know if my 46 is much wider than your 40, but I don't think so. I used seats out of a 98 mark VIII, the out side holes match right up to the 46 seats so I just had to drill the inside holes
by the hump. You will have to build a riser as the mark seat slope
to the front some or sit level.

If you have a 2dr the back seat will fit right in, just lift the back off of the holder, take out the bottom, put the bottom in place from the Mark. You might have to bring the front of the seat up some, take a 2x4 and screw it to the board that is there. I let the 2x4 rest on the tunnel hump and just leveled it from that. Then just hang the mark seat right on to the holders for the 40 back they fit right on, change nothing. When I got mine I got all the seat belts, the bolts, all the hardware for the belts and put them in also. Front and back.

The seats are electric every way, plus heated.
